Second opinion sector rockets
Second opinion providers are emerging as viable, large-scale businesses.
Thanks to the internet, telehealth and teleradiology second opinion providers are coming of age. Your average Joe can get access to the right elite doctor to consult on almost any condition. This opens up a global market for medical expertise.
It could also clip the wings of elite hospital groups, private and public, who could previously claim a monopoly on this expertise.
Second opinion groups are surprisingly large. Barcelona-based Advance Medical expects sales to all but double from €60m in 2015 to €100m in 2018. Best Doctors are making health tech acquisitions and a US VC fund has valued another operator at $750m in a recent deal. Who says that healthcare services can not innovate?
